The question is: How far can a 45 ACP bullet travel? The answer is that a 45 ACP bullet can travel up to a maximum distance of 1,800 yards, which is roughly a mile. However, this is the absolute maximum range, and the effective range for practical and accurate shooting is much shorter.

Maximum Distance of a 45 ACP Bullet
The 45 ACP maximum distance is about 1,800 yards (roughly one mile). This number assumes the bullet is fired at an ideal angle in perfect conditions. In real-world situations, this distance is rarely achievable or safe to test. This is because you would need very specific conditions to reach this range.
Effective Range
While the maximum distance tells how far the bullet can go, the 45 ACP effective range is how far you can shoot accurately and with enough force to stop a threat.
What is Effective Range?
Effective range means the distance at which you can reliably hit a target and have the bullet do enough damage. For the 45 ACP, this range is much less than its maximum distance.
Factors Determining Effective Range
- Accuracy: Can you consistently hit your target?
- Stopping Power: Does the bullet have enough energy to stop a threat?
- Practical Use: Is the distance useful in real-world situations?
Typical Effective Range of 45 ACP
For self-defense, the effective range of a 45 ACP is generally considered to be 25 yards or less. At this distance, a trained shooter can reliably hit a target, and the bullet has enough energy to be effective.

Bullet Trajectory Explained
The 45 ACP bullet trajectory is curved because of gravity and air resistance. The bullet starts to drop as soon as it leaves the barrel. The amount of drop depends on the bullet’s velocity, weight, and shape. Understanding bullet trajectory is important for accurate 45 ACP long range shooting.
Here’s an example of how bullet drop might look for a standard 230-grain 45 ACP round:
Distance (Yards) | Bullet Drop (Inches) |
---|---|
25 | 0 |
50 | -1.5 |
75 | -4.5 |
100 | -9 |
Note: These numbers are approximate and can change with different ammunition and guns.

Different Types of 45 ACP Ammunition and Their Range
The type of ammunition used affects range and performance. Here are some common types:
Full Metal Jacket (FMJ)
- Characteristics: FMJ rounds are designed for penetration and are often used for target practice.
- Range: They have a good range due to their shape and weight.
- Typical Uses: Target shooting, training.
Hollow Point (HP)
- Characteristics: Hollow point rounds are designed to expand upon impact, increasing stopping power.
- Range: Their range may be slightly less than FMJ rounds due to their design.
- Typical Uses: Self-defense, law enforcement.
Jacketed Hollow Point (JHP)
- Characteristics: Similar to hollow points but with a jacket around the lead for better feeding and expansion.
- Range: Slightly better range than standard hollow points.
- Typical Uses: Self-defense, law enforcement.
+P Ammunition
- Characteristics: +P ammunition is loaded to higher pressures, resulting in increased velocity and energy.
- Range: Increased velocity can extend the effective range.
- Typical Uses: Self-defense, situations where maximum stopping power is needed.
Shot Shell
- Characteristics: .45 ACP shotshell rounds contain small pellets instead of a single bullet.
- Range: Very limited range, typically used for close-range pest control or practice.
- Typical Uses: Pest control, training.

Why is the 45 ACP Still Popular?
Despite being an older cartridge, the 45 ACP remains popular due to its reputation for stopping power and reliability. Many shooters prefer its heavier bullet and larger caliber for self-defense.
- Stopping Power: The 45 ACP delivers significant energy on impact.
- Accuracy: In skilled hands, the 45 ACP can be very accurate.
- Availability: Ammunition and firearms are widely available.
